> It’s a simple example of apposition, James. It’s not a construct. As Don
> pointed out, no pronominal suffix may attach to a word in construct. That
> fact alone tells us that בהררם is NOT in construct. It is in the status
> pronominalis, which is the state of a noun taking a pronominal suffix.
